    Israel Jenkins House, also known as The Elms, is a historic home located near Marion, in Monroe Township, Grant County, Indiana.It was built about 1840, and is a 2 + 1 ⁄ 2-story, vernacular Greek Revival style, double pile brick dwelling.

    The Survey and Registration Section of the Indiana Division of Historic Preservation and Archaeology oversees this state register. All places within Indiana that are listed on the National Register of Historic Places are automatically on Indiana's Register.     Marion Downtown Commercial Historic District is a national historic district located at Marion, Grant County, Indiana. It encompasses 52 contributing buildings, 2 contributing structures, and 1 contributing object in the central business district of Marion.

    The Richmond Downtown Historic District is an area of primarily commercial buildings and national historic district located at Richmond, Wayne County, Indiana.The district encompasses 47 contributing buildings located along the National Road.
